About Eric Masika

Eric Masika is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Inorganic Chemistry, Biomedical Engineering,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ment, having authored 18 papers that have together received 632 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Zeolite Catalysis and Synthesis (3 papers), Metal-Organic Frameworks: Synthesis and Applications (3 papers), TiO2 Photocatalysis and Solar Cells (3 papers), Hydrogen Storage and Materials (3 papers), Advanced Photocatalysis Techniques (2 papers), Nanoparticles: synthesis and applications (2 papers), Catalytic Processes in Materials Science (2 papers) and Supercapacitor Materials and Fabrication (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Materials Chemistry (422 citations), Inorganic Chemistry (126 citations),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(125 citations), Energy Engineering and Power Technology (18 citations) and Process Chemistry and Technology (16 citations). Eric Masika has collaborated with scholars based in Kenya, United Kingdom and United States. Frequent co-authors include Robert Mokaya, Dickson Andala, Naumih M. Noah, Beatrice Adeniran, Lucy M. Ombaka, Margaret M. Ng’ang’a, Peter M. Ndangili, Thomas W. Chamberlain, Richard A. Bourne and Paul O. Mireji.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Materials Chemistry A, The Journal of Physical Chemistry C, Energy & Environmental Science, Progress in Natural Science Materials International and Chemistry of Materials.
